当前位置: 首页 > 知识库问答 >
问题:

Drupal 8打开社会新的子主题不显示在外观

段干开宇
2023-03-14

我正在使用Drupal的开放式社交框架,其中我复制了socialblue主题,以便在新主题中进行修改。我按照下面的步骤,清除了缓存,但我无法在管理/外观部分看到我的新主题。

我采取了以下步骤:

1) 我将主题socialblue(html/profiles/contrib/social/themes/socialblue)复制到了newtheme(html/profiles/contrib/social/themes/newtheme)

2) 我在“newtheme”目录中搜索(socialblue)并替换(newtheme)

3) 我将以下文件的名称从“socialblue”更改为“newtheme”

  • newtheme.info.yml
  • newtheme.libraries.yml
  • newtheme.theme
  • 配置/安装/newtheme.settings.yml

4) 我创建了一个/html/sites/default/services。默认情况下的yml文件。服务。yml进行了以下更改

  • 小树枝。配置-
  • 小树枝。配置-

5)html/配置文件/配置文件/社会/主题/新主题

6) html/profiles/contrib/social/themes/newtheme$sudo npm安装-g gulp cli

7) html/profiles/contrib/social/themes/newtheme$gulp

我没有得到任何错误。我确保我的newtheme.info文件有名称new主题。我也复制了这个新主题在html/主题/自定义/新主题仍然没有运气。我是不是漏了什么?

共有1个答案

姜华翰
2023-03-14

我解决了。原来是因为我的基本主题被提到为“社会蓝”。我把它改成了“社会基础”,结果成功了。我不知道一个父主题是否可以在Drupal 8中有多个子主题。

 类似资料:
  • 问题内容: 我正在将PHP与Ajax和JQuery一起进行试验,以创建一个可以在其中写入文本文件的站点,然后让该站点将文本文件的内容加载到div中。 这是我正在使用的JQuery代码。 这是PHP和相关的HTML。 因此,它的作用是让用户使用#wordinput写入“ text.txt”,然后使用.load()更新#text以显示来自“ text.txt”的新更新文本。然后,其他用户也可以查看并写

  • 我对CSS相对较新,对Liferay也很陌生。我正在尝试构建一个自定义主题。只是为了测试,我试图更改页面上portlet的标题文本颜色。在我的custom.css,我有 我假设这是正确的类,因为在这个类下的firefox检查器中添加颜色会改变颜色。然而,当我部署主题时,它会恢复为 如果我ftp到主题的文件夹,我所做的更改仍然是自定义的。css。出于某种原因,当主题在Liferay中呈现时,它会从我

  • 所以我试图让我的按钮在我的导航抽屉碎片中打开新的活动,但是我的mainactivity中有什么东西坏了。java 我的mainactivity.java.... 我的奖励碎片... } 问题是它在下有一个红色下划线,我不知道如何修复它 我试过了所有的办法,这就是我目前所拥有的… } 我的setContentView是鲜红的,我的findViewByID是红色的,最后是(rewardsFragmen

  • 现在我想在wordpress管理中编辑我的主题的style.css文件,但它不显示完整的内容,它只是一些摘要信息。但是当我通过ssh登录我的主机时,我可以在style.css.中看到完整的内容

  • 我的数据确实显示在console.log中,但实际上没有显示在表中,我在这里做错了什么?

  • 我想使用Selenium WebDriver和Python在不同的选项卡中打开相当多的URL。 在我的代码中有什么可以改变的地方来让新的URL在new选项卡中打开吗? 谢谢你的帮助!